描述This book focuses on both high-density lipoproteins (HDL) metabolism and related diseases from the perspectives of the world-class experts in HDL. Several chapters in this book provide the overall information about HDL metabolism via detailed discussion of HDL structures as well as several key molecules involved in its functions, such as SR-B1 and Cholesteryl Ester Transfer Protein Inhibitors and so on. The rest of this book illustrates the connection between HDL and several diseases that are the major concerns of people’s health in many countries, and devotes to exploring the therapies of HDL related diseases. With a better understanding of the HDL metabolism and diseases, this book will benefit the audiences with interest in HDL from biomedicine to clinical practice.

https://doi.org/10.1007/978-3-030-29509-7density lipoproteins (HDLs). HDLs and the main HDL apolipoprotein, apoA-I, improves pancreatic beta cell function. ApoA-I also improves insulin sensitivity. The development of novel, bifunctional HDL-based interventions are a promising therapeutic option for the treatment of cardiometabolic diseases.
